The Bay Area continues to be under a Flood Watch and Wind Advisory as a Level 3 storm and atmospheric river hit the region. Here's what to expect.

ABC7 Meteorologist Drew Tuma says the time for the highest impacts is until 4 a.m. Friday. This is the window for strongest winds and rounds of heavy rain.The highest rainfall totals will be found in the higher terrain of the North Bay and Santa Cruz Mountains where shallow mudslides are possible as soils are fairly saturated from recent rain.

The threat for roadway flooding and stream flooding will be highest on Friday morning across the Bay Area.East Bay 1"-3"We will see damaging winds Thursday night into Friday morning with gusts of 30-50 mph+. This will bring trees down and will likely lead to isolated power outages.Heavy snow above 6,500 ft with 2-6 feet of snow in areas that remain cold enough for it. Areas below 6,500 ft will see all rain with some areas exceeding 6"+ of rainfall.
